Inspection items of chemical storage tank manufacturers
The storage tank is classified as special equipment and needs to be inspected regularly to avoid safety hazards. The inspection of the storage tank is divided into external inspection and internal inspection. External inspection refers to the inspection of various parts and components of the tank while it contains media; internal inspection is conducted after the media inside the tank has been emptied, inspecting various parts and components of the tank.

Classification of heat transfer principles in heat exchanger manufacturers
Surface heat exchangers are devices where two fluids at different temperatures flow in a space separated by a wall. Heat transfer occurs through the conduction of the wall and the convection of the fluids at the wall surface. Surface heat exchangers include shell-and-tube, double-pipe, and other types of heat exchangers.
